Runbook — Orlan firmware channel rollback. If devices on the stable channel report checksum mismatches, freeze the channel first, then repoint the manifest to the prior release. Do not delete the bad artifact; quarantine it for analysis. Confirm at least three canary devices boot the prior image before unfreezing. Note the rollback build reference directly below.

build token for haduf-bafog: htk21_2d98ce91a83676b65394a

## Handover — Inventory Reconciliation Job

Quick brain-dump before I rotate off. The nightly StockSettle job compares warehouse counts against the Cartographa ledger and flags variances over 2%. It's been stable since we fixed the double-count on returns, but watch the Tuesday run — that's when the Bramblehollow depot syncs late and you'll see false positives. If it pages, just requeue once before digging in. Release notes template is in the runbook. Going forward, ownership and any release sign-off questions go to the person named below.

named custodian: Belius Casath Ulaix Sorius

## 2024-06-11 — Key rotation for Bramblewick SFTP drop

Heads up: we rotated the deploy key for the Bramblewick partner SFTP drop after their ops folks flagged the old one as stale. The nightly push from feedrunner now uses the new key; the old one gets revoked Friday. If the 02:00 transfer fails, don't panic — just swap the key in the feedrunner secrets bundle and rerun. For reference, the new deploy key is below.

deploy key for kajof-fajop: bky6_gDHw9Q

Runbook: GratiPost Receipt Mailer. New folks: the mailer runs every fifteen minutes and batches receipts per donor. If receipts stall, check the queue depth first, then the template cache. Redeploys require a fresh .env in the worker directory with the SMTP host and sender fields filled in. The mailer's API secret should be added on the line immediately following.

sealed setting: VAULT_KEY20=c8ea1e419912889df6b4